Как увеличить кол-во символов в поле заголовок InstantCMS 2?

#1 6 ноября 2014 в 17:04
Возникла подобная необходимость. Для моего сайта недостаточно 100 символов, необходимо 150-200. И поле Текст HTML тоже обрезается, вероятно тоже связано с подобным ограничением. Подскажите, как это исправить?
#2 6 ноября 2014 в 17:14
\system\controllers\content\model.php
в 66 строке меняй на нужное число

скорее всего еще в бд надо поменять, сейчас гляну

UPD


Вот на примере постов, надо сменить размер поля title со 100 так же на Ваше значение

Теоретически должно работать

UPD2

Только вместо таблицы "cms_con_post" выберите нужную таблицу, отвечающую за Ваш тип контента
#3 6 ноября 2014 в 23:30
Александр, спасибо большое!
#4 6 ноября 2014 в 23:58
/system/fields/caption.php а вообще можно это отредактировать в этом файле?

<?php

class fieldCaption extends cmsFormField {

public $title = LANG_PARSER_CAPTION;
public $is_public = false;
public $sql = 'varchar(255) NULL DEFAULT NULL';
public $filter_type = 'str';
я здесь поменял 255 на более большее число, но ничего не поменялось. Это делается не тут или это только будет действительно для заголовков нового типа контента?
#5 7 ноября 2014 в 00:10
Проверил с заголовками, всё равно обрезается до 100, только нет предупреждения, что заголовок не соответствует, но, кажется, я уже видел где это исправить.
#6 7 ноября 2014 в 08:17

всё равно обрезается до 100

Сега
вы в настройках поля в базе поменяли varchar(100) на побольше? Судя по цитате — нет.
#7 7 ноября 2014 в 08:29

кажется, я уже видел где это исправить.

Сега
100%)
Иллюстрация
#8 7 ноября 2014 в 13:12
Евгений, reload, Нет, в БД я всё поправил.

всё равно обрезается до 100, только нет предупреждения,

Сега
#9 7 ноября 2014 в 13:13
max_length: 250
#10 7 ноября 2014 в 13:17
Или это надо как-то здесь исправить?
#11 7 ноября 2014 в 13:23
Обратил внимание что не в ту таблицу лезу zst, но в cms_con_posts у меня немного другое выводится
#12 7 ноября 2014 в 13:32
я разобрался как увеличить 100 до 250 в заголовке. но что мне сделать чтобы исправить максимальную длину htmlтекста. туда у меня помещает чуть больше 30 тыс символов. Это может быть как-то связано с этим?
#13 7 ноября 2014 в 19:41


я разобрался как увеличить 100 до 250 в заголовке. но что мне сделать чтобы исправить максимальную длину htmlтекста. туда у меня помещает чуть больше 30 тыс символов. Это может быть как-то связано с этим?

Сега

Напиши в личку или в скайп xpohoc14
#14 9 ноября 2014 в 16:44
Для тех, у кого html-текст обрезается, в БД смените тип строки content с text на medium text
#15 26 октября 2015 в 23:00
У меня не получается поменять максимальную длину заголовка.

1. В файле \system\controllers\content\model.php поменял 'max_length' => на 200
2. В БД в cms_con_quotes (мой тип контента) поменял title на varchar(200)

Создаю публикацию — получаю страницу 404.

3. поменял еще значение в cms_con_quotes_fields — в title на varchar(200)

не помогло.

Наверное еще где-то нужно поменять?
Вы не можете отвечать в этой теме.
Войдите или зарегистрируйтесь, чтобы писать на форуме.
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.